Understanding Self-Perception

Self-perception plays a crucial role in shaping an individuals mindset and behavior. It encompasses how we view ourselves, our abilities, and our worth in the world. For women, societal conditioning and ingrained stereotypes can significantly influence their self-perception, often leading to self-doubt and imposter syndrome.

  • Imposter Syndrome: Many women experience imposter syndrome, a phenomenon where individuals doubt their accomplishments and fear being exposed as frauds. This psychological pattern can stem from societal pressure to conform to unrealistic standards of perfection.
  • Societal Conditioning: From a young age, girls are often taught to be modest, accommodating, and self-effacing. These societal norms can clash with womens ambitions and confidence, creating a disconnect between their actual abilities and perceived capabilities.
